Embracing the Future: Understanding the Impact and Ethics of AI and Automation Across Industries

In today’s rapidly advancing technological landscape, AI and automation are revolutionizing various industries by transforming the way we live and work. AI, or artificial intelligence, refers to the development of computer systems that can perform tasks that typically require human intelligence, such as problem-solving, learning, reasoning, and decision-making. On the other hand, automation involves the use of technology and machines to perform tasks with minimal human intervention. Together, AI and automation are driving innovation and reshaping the way we approach different sectors.

Applications of AI and automation

The impact of AI and automation can be seen in numerous industries, showcasing their potential to drive efficiency, improve processes, and enhance customer experiences. In the healthcare sector, AI-driven diagnosis has become a game-changer, accelerating patient care and improving outcomes. By leveraging AI algorithms, medical professionals can analyze vast amounts of data, identify patterns, and make accurate diagnoses more quickly than ever before.

In the finance industry, automation plays a crucial role in streamlining processes and improving customer interactions. Automated trading systems enable faster and more precise transactions, while chatbots provide efficient customer support and guidance. These automated systems not only save time and resources but also enhance the overall customer experience.

The manufacturing sector is witnessing a shift towards collaborative robots that work seamlessly alongside human workers. These robots, known as cobots, are designed to enhance production by automating repetitive tasks, reducing errors, and improving workplace safety. With cobots in place, manufacturers can increase productivity while ensuring the well-being of their employees.

Retail has also been transformed by AI and automation. Powered by recommendation algorithms, personalized customer experiences have become the new norm. Online platforms analyze customer data to provide tailored recommendations, making shopping more convenient and efficient. This personalization helps retailers build stronger relationships with customers, fostering loyalty and driving sales.

Transportation is on the cusp of a major transformation as self-driving vehicles, guided by AI technology, promise safer roads and more efficient transport systems. Automakers and tech giants are investing heavily in autonomous vehicles, envisioning a future where traffic accidents become a thing of the past. With AI at the wheel, transportation is poised to undergo a revolution that will redefine mobility.

Impact on the workforce

While automation is automating routine tasks and providing new opportunities, its implications for the workforce are complex. As automation replaces certain jobs, there is a need for individuals to upskill and adapt to new roles. However, it’s important to note that automation is not solely about job displacement. Instead, it has the potential to create new positions that require human skills such as creativity, critical thinking, and problem-solving. By understanding these shifts, individuals can navigate the changing job landscape and proactively embrace the opportunities that arise.

Ethical considerations

As AI and automation become increasingly integrated into our daily lives, it is essential to address ethical concerns. One notable issue is bias in AI algorithms. Since AI systems learn from existing data, they can perpetuate biases present within that data, leading to discriminatory outcomes. To mitigate this, careful attention must be paid to ensuring that AI algorithms are developed and trained with robust ethical frameworks that promote fairness and equity.

Another area of concern is the erosion of privacy in a data-driven world. AI relies on data collection and analysis, which raises questions about the ethical use and storage of personal information. It is crucial for businesses and policymakers to establish comprehensive data protection regulations that safeguard individuals’ privacy while also enabling the benefits of AI and automation.

The concerns surrounding job displacement also need to be carefully considered. While automation may eliminate certain positions, new jobs will emerge that require human oversight, creativity, and adaptability. By investing in reskilling and providing support for affected workers, societies can ensure a smooth transition and mitigate the potential negative impacts on individuals and communities.

Importance of Ethical Guidelines and Regulation

To address the ethical challenges posed by AI and automation effectively, stringent ethical guidelines and comprehensive regulation are imperative. Transparency is key in AI development and deployment, ensuring that algorithms are explainable and accountable. By opening up the black box of AI, individuals can trust in the technology and its applications.

Fairness must also be a priority. Algorithms should be designed and audited to prevent bias and discrimination, improving the representation and inclusivity of AI systems. Additionally, accountability mechanisms should be in place to handle potential issues effectively and ensure that those responsible for any negative outcomes are held accountable for their actions.
